Negreanu Busts Redraw Coming

Level 15 : 700/2,500, 500 ante
Daniel Negreanu
Daniel Negreanu

Daniel Negreanu has been eliminated in 25th place by Frank Kassela, and we are now redrawing to three tables. When we arrived at the table, the hands looked like this:

Negreanu: {j-Hearts}{4-Hearts}{j-Diamonds}{q-Hearts}{q-Spades}{3-Spades}
Kassela: {a-Hearts}{a-Clubs}{a-Diamonds}{k-Spades}{8-Spades}{7-Spades}{2-Hearts}

On seventh, Negreanu was dealt paint - a queen would've given him a full house - but it was a meaningless {k-}, and Kid Poker was eliminated just short of the redraw.

Seiver Trumps Richardson and Leah

Level 15 : 700/2,500, 500 ante

Catching the action on fifth street we found Scott Seiver betting out 5,000 and both John Richardson and Mike Leah calling.

On sixth Seiver again bet with both opponents calling before Richardson would bet seventh as each player's board looked as followed.

Seiver: {X-}{X-} / {6-Spades}{3-Hearts}{3-Diamonds}{A-Hearts} / {X-}
Richardson: {X-}{X-} / {Q-Clubs}{8-Diamonds}{A-Diamonds}{6-Diamonds} / {X-}
Leah: {X-}{X-} / {K-Spades}{8-Clubs}{7-Clubs}{5-Clubs} / {X-}

Leah would fold, but Seiver made the call tabling his {Q-Spades}{3-Spades}{X-} to best Richardson's {A-Clubs}{Q-Clubs}{10-Clubs} for aces-up.

Sexton Scoops a Big One

Level 15 : 700/2,500, 500 ante
Mike Sexton
Mike Sexton

Mike Sexton: {x-}{x-} / {7-Clubs}{10-Spades}{5-Diamonds}{j-Clubs} / {x-}
Michael Mizrachi: {x-}{x-} / {q-Diamonds}{3-Hearts}{5-Hearts}{9-Diamonds} / {x-}
Adam Friedman: {x-}{x-} / {10-Hearts}{a-Spades}{q-Hearts}{3-Diamonds} / {x-}

We reached the table on sixth street, where Friedman checked, Sexton bet, and both Mizrachi and Friedman called. The same action occurred on seventh, but before calling, Friedman called Sexton's hand.

"OK, Mike," he sighed. "Show the eight-nine."

Sexton obliged, flipping over {9-Hearts}{8-Spades}{7-Spades} to scoop the pot with a straight.
